SX 35 NE SHEVIOCK SHEVIOCK

2/316 Pair of monuments to the Stephens family in the churchyard about 6 metres south of Church of St Mary GV II

Pair of headstones. Late C18 and early C19. Slate. Headstone with stepped shaped head and verses, to William Stephens, 1784. Headstone with shouldered segmental head and valedictory quatrain, to John Stephens, 1805.
